Transaction 467269505e0683afb0fad307387b3e6974240b2f09560c9be952c53ecb02e0f2
1 Input
1 Output
-
467269505e0683afb0fad307387b3e6974240b2f09560c9be952c53ecb02e0f2:0
- value
- 67643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0c12f142aef15281689ee1e1a8559d1e461abdc OP_EQUAL
- address
- 3HocGxZK6GApncpaJn28e4MixuKTPtxDEe